Most countries treat artificial intelligence as something you buy from someone else. You rent compute from a cloud provider. You use models trained by American or Chinese companies. You store data in a server farm owned by a multinational corporation.
Saudi Arabia has decided that model is not good enough. On September 2, 2026, Saudi AI infrastructure company OmniOps signed a memorandum of understanding with Hewlett Packard Enterprise at LEAP 2026, the Kingdom’s flagship technology event. The deal combines HPE’s locally manufactured servers with OmniOps’ Saudi-built AI platform called Bunyan, creating a full stack where the hardware, the software, and the deployment all happen inside Saudi borders.
The agreement matters because it stretches the definition of sovereignty further than most governments have been willing to go.
Data Residency Is Only the Beginning
For years, governments and regulated industries understood sovereignty as a simple question. Where does the data sit? If data stays inside the country, the thinking went, sovereignty is preserved.
That definition is incomplete, and the gap has become a problem.
Mohammed Altassan, founding CEO of OmniOps, explained the limitation directly. He said his customers across government, aviation, and financial services need answers to three separate questions. They want to know where their data sits, who built the platform running on top of it, and where the hardware underneath it comes from.
Data residency answers only the first question. A company can store your data in a local data center while the software managing that data was built and controlled by a foreign company. The hardware processing the data can come from another jurisdiction entirely. Each layer represents a potential point of dependence.
The OmniOps and HPE deal closes those gaps by connecting all three layers. HPE manufactures the servers through its Saudi Made initiative. OmniOps builds the AI management software. Both companies deploy and support the system within Saudi Arabia.

Bunyan Solves a Specific Problem for Regulated Industries
OmniOps built Bunyan as an AI inference platform. Inference is the process where AI models make decisions or generate outputs from data. Banks use it to detect fraud. Hospitals use it to analyse medical images. Airlines use it to optimise operations.
Bunyan allows organisations to deploy these AI workloads across different environments. They can run on public cloud, on private servers inside their own buildings, or on air-gapped systems that never connect to the internet. This flexibility matters for sectors like defence, healthcare, and finance, where regulations often forbid sending sensitive data to third-party systems.
The platform is hardware-agnostic. It can run on different types of computing equipment, which preserves customer choice and prevents lock-in to a single vendor.
A Kurdish AI Platform Shows the Model Works
The sovereignty argument is not theoretical. OmniOps proved the model works through a deployment in the Kurdistan Region of Iraq.
In June 2026, OmniOps partnered with Newroz Telecom to launch KI, the first Kurdish conversational AI platform. The system runs on Bunyan and operates entirely on-premises within Newroz Telecom’s infrastructure. Data and AI processing stay inside the Kurdistan Region.
KI supports Kurdish dialects including Sorani, Badini, and Kurmanji, along with Arabic and English. For Kurdish speakers, this means access to AI services in their native language for the first time. For governments considering sovereign AI strategies, it demonstrates that advanced AI can run locally without sacrificing performance or security.
Mohammed Altassan described the philosophy behind the deployment. He said sovereign AI is the foundation of trust, and that advanced AI can be deployed rapidly and locally without compromising data control.
HPE Built the Manufacturing Layer Over Several Years
The OmniOps agreement did not emerge from nowhere. HPE has spent years building the infrastructure required to manufacture and support technology inside Saudi Arabia.
In 2026, HPE expanded its Saudi Made portfolio to include enterprise storage systems produced locally. The company deepened its relationship with Alfanar, a Saudi manufacturing firm that assembles, configures, and tests HPE servers before they reach customers. This means organisations can receive infrastructure that is already built, pre-integrated, and ready to deploy, rather than importing equipment and configuring it themselves.
HPE also announced plans for a Saudi Innovation Center in Riyadh, where customers, startups, and solution providers can test technologies and collaborate on new products.
The Saudi Made, Developed, Deployed initiative represents a deliberate strategy to build every layer of the technology stack locally. The program connects local manufacturing with Saudi-developed applications and services from companies like OmniOps, ShaheenAI, and MOZN.
The Shift Toward Execution Sovereignty
The OmniOps deal reflects a change happening across the global AI industry. Analysts describe a shift from data residency to what they call execution sovereignty.
The distinction matters because AI agents now move data across systems and borders to perform tasks. An agent might read a document stored in one location, process it in another, and write results somewhere else. If the processing happens on foreign infrastructure, sovereignty breaks even if the original data never moved.
Governments and regulated industries are responding by demanding control over where AI work actually runs, not just where data sits. The sovereign cloud market is projected to exceed $200 billion by 2029, growing at roughly 38 percent annually.
Saudi Arabia’s approach positions the Kingdom ahead of this curve. By building hardware, software, and deployment capabilities domestically, Saudi organisations can answer all three sovereignty questions that Mohammed Altassan outlined.
